Title: Celebrating the Innovations of Inventor Taiichi Ohra
Introduction: Taiichi Ohra, a talented inventor based in Izumi, Japan, has made his mark in the field of chemical compounds with a notable patent. His work contributes to the vast landscape of innovations that drive modern technology and pharmaceuticals.
Latest Patents: Ohra holds a patent for "Bicyclic quinone compounds, their production and use." This innovation involves a compound with a specific chemical formula, showcasing his expertise in the development of complex chemicals valuable for various applications in science and industry.
Career Highlights: Taiichi Ohra is affiliated with Takeda Chemical Industries, Inc., a prominent player in the pharmaceutical industry. His role within this esteemed company has allowed him to utilize his skills in chemistry to enhance the development of innovative products.
Collaborations: Throughout his career, Ohra has collaborated with other notable inventors, including Kaneyoshi Kato and Masaomi Miyamoto.
